Summary of articles on Light Activated Disinfection and FotoSan
Photodynamic therapy (PDT), also known as photoradiation therapy, phototherapy, or photochemo therapy, involves the use of a photoactive dye (photosensitizer) that is activated by exposure to light of a specific wavelength in the presence of oxygen. متن کاملPhoto-activated disinfection of the root canal: a new role for lasers in endodontics.
Because micro-organisms play a crucial role in the development of pulpal and periapical disease, the prognosis of endodontic therapy is intimately related to the presence of bacteria within the root canal system.
